burn-plugin startet vdr (1.3.22) neu

  • Ich starte hier mal neu, da sich die Probleme beim maken des Plugins erledigt haben.
    Siehe hier.


    Ich habe nun folgende Probleme mit dem burn-Plugin:


    was geht:
    1. ich kann ein oder mehrere Aufnahmen auswähen
    2. wenn ich ins burn Plugin wechsele werden die gewählten Aufnahmen angezeigt.
    3. ich kann wählen, ob eine ISO, DVD oder beides erstellt werden sollen.


    was geht nicht:
    1. sobald ich den roten Knopf für erstellen wähle, verschwindet das Live Signal.
    2. die Oberfläche des burn Plugins wird noch ein paar Sekunden angezeigt.
    3. der VDR mach einen Neustart.


    meine Probleme:
    1. ich weiß nicht wie ich requant installieren muß.
    2. ich bekomme keine Meldungen (außer Neustart) in der syslog.
    3. ich weiß nicht was als erstes passiert, wenn ich erstellen wähle um erst mal in der Shell zu testen (Befehle).


    Ich habe das burn Plugin 0.0.5 mit dem Patch aus obigem Link am laufen(schön wärs).
    VDR ist Version 1.3.22
    Plugins habe ich mit "make DDVDDEV=/dev/hdc ISODIR=/mnt/neu/ISO-PAT DEBUG=1 plugins" erstellt.


    Ich hofe es kann mir jemand helfen, ohne Logeinträge bin ich aufgeschmissen.



    Schon mal vielen Dank !

    Clients:2xShuttle XPC SK41G; Diskless; 1xFF DVB-S; Duron 1400@1050MHz; Medion USB Remote + VDRMediaClients
    File-Server:AMD K7 900MHz;13GB root;30GB home; 4x160GB Soft.-Raid5 video
    TV-Server:AMD K7 700@1000MHz;5GB root; 3xTwinhan DTV Sat

  • Zur Ergänzung, ich habe folgende Befehle ausführen können:
    vdrsync.pl -o /mnt/neu/ISO-PAT/neu.0 /video/King_of_Queens/2005-03-07.19.41.90.50.rec
    tcmplex -i /mnt/neu/ISO-PAT/e0.mpv -p /mnt/neu/ISO-PAT/c0.mpa -m d -o /mnt/neu/ISO-PAT/test.mpg


    und kann mir die erzeugte test.mpg auch ohne Probleme anschauen.


    Wie wäre der nächste Befehl den burn ausführt ?

    Clients:2xShuttle XPC SK41G; Diskless; 1xFF DVB-S; Duron 1400@1050MHz; Medion USB Remote + VDRMediaClients
    File-Server:AMD K7 900MHz;13GB root;30GB home; 4x160GB Soft.-Raid5 video
    TV-Server:AMD K7 700@1000MHz;5GB root; 3xTwinhan DTV Sat

  • Also ich habe requant nun mit:
    cp requant /usr/local/bin
    mit reingenommen aber immer noch das gleiche.


    Gibt es denn keine Möglichkeit dem Plugin eine Fehlermeldung zu entlocken ?
    Ich habe es doch mit der debug Option erstellt. :computertod

    Clients:2xShuttle XPC SK41G; Diskless; 1xFF DVB-S; Duron 1400@1050MHz; Medion USB Remote + VDRMediaClients
    File-Server:AMD K7 900MHz;13GB root;30GB home; 4x160GB Soft.-Raid5 video
    TV-Server:AMD K7 700@1000MHz;5GB root; 3xTwinhan DTV Sat

  • Es liegt definitiv allein am PlugIn oder der eingespielte Patch.


    Ich habe mal das burn Plugin von eric Pack von VDR 1.3.21 und dort läufts.


    Allerdings läuft es nicht im Paket von VDR 1.3.22 . Da habe ich das selbe Phenomen das plötzlich nen Restart gibt.




    I30R6










    VDR











    Hardware : GA-EP35-DS3L, C2Q Q6700 , 3GB DDR2 , Palit GT240, 250GB System & 500GB Video,
    Mystique-CaBix C2,TT Budget C-1501,Airstar 2, Fernbedienung X10
    Software : gen2vdr, Kernel 3.8.10, vdr 2.0.1
    PlugIns : audiorecorder,femon,admin,yacoto..
    Ausgabe: softhddevice

    Einmal editiert, zuletzt von I30R6 ()

  • I30R6


    :welle


    Zitat

    Es liegt definitiv allein am PlugIn oder der eingespielte Patch.


    Ich habe mal das burn Plugin von eric Pack von VDR 1.3.21 und dort läufts.


    Volltreffer! Hab mir auch das burn aus dem 1.3.21 Pack geholt.
    Läuft damit auch unter 1.3.22 auf anhieb.


    Vielen Dank für Deine Mühe!

    Clients:2xShuttle XPC SK41G; Diskless; 1xFF DVB-S; Duron 1400@1050MHz; Medion USB Remote + VDRMediaClients
    File-Server:AMD K7 900MHz;13GB root;30GB home; 4x160GB Soft.-Raid5 video
    TV-Server:AMD K7 700@1000MHz;5GB root; 3xTwinhan DTV Sat

  • lösung: im video verzeichnis muss ein ordner namens vdr-burn sein, bevor ihr brennt.


    das wars bei mir.


    das hatter hier hardgecoded:


    asprintf(&path, "%s/vdr-burn/vdr-burn.XXXXXX", Datadir);


    wenn das fehlt knallter mit segfault raus.


    falls andere ursache:


    das hier zur analyse in process.c einbauen und ins syslog kucken:


    cBurnProcess::cBurnProcess(int NumSteps) {
    char *path;
    asprintf(&path, "%s/vdr-burn/vdr-burn.XXXXXX", Datadir); // mag keine versteckten
    mStatus = rsNone;
    mCmdline = NULL;
    mProcedure = NULL;
    mProcData = NULL;
    mActive = false;
    mProgress = 0;
    mNumSteps = NumSteps;
    mCurStep = 0;
    mNextStep = nsContinue;
    mSubStep = -1;
    mBurning = false;
    mBurnProgress = 0;
    if(! (mTempDir = mkdtemp(path)))
    esyslog("vdr::cBurnProcess::cBurnProcess::mkdtemp(path) %s %s \n", path, strerror(errno)); // und das hier für meldung, knallt aber dann trotzdem :)
    mLogFile = NULL;
    }


    gruss

    VDR1: yavdr ppa VDR 2.0.6 auf iBase Industrial Mini-ITX MB896IL +DVI- Modul +Gb Ethernet Mini-PCI Motherboard, Pentium M 740, 1GB RAM, mit 3x KNC1 C+/MK3 PCI auf LSI Logic 3x PCI-64 Rev. 2.3 Intel 21154 aktive Riser Card 2135-5V mit abgesägtem 64Bit- Steckerteil im PCI- Slot auf upriser,
    HDTV xineliboutput mit xine-plugin-crystalhd für Broadcom CrystalHD BCM970015 auf 15cm PCI-E 1x Flachbandriser im PCI-E 1x v.1.0a Slot.
    IPTV vdr-plugin-iptv und ffmpeg als rtsp/rtmp/hls "tuner frontend", stream sanitizer und mpegts wrapper.

    Einmal editiert, zuletzt von woprr ()

Jetzt mitmachen!

Sie haben noch kein Benutzerkonto auf unserer Seite? Registrieren Sie sich kostenlos und nehmen Sie an unserer Community teil!